The Beijing opera niche hairdo crown headwear is a symbol of power, status, and elegance in Chinese culture.
It is often worn by male performers during performances of this traditional art form, which combines music, dance, and drama.
The crown itself is made from high-quality materials such as silk or velvet, and its intricate design features intricate embroidery, beading, and other embellishments.
